Output 62a99dc31809a19e1a57809d1660459109bb2fc51caf09f1c1867d0d76e6a681:1

value
37137543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758c50d6dd76f95d36a98f0b4cb89f7c6c72e543 OP_EQUAL
address
3CQZ5JJWf8yEGmPaaofg6QXbQ88c2Q2eA1
transaction
62a99dc31809a19e1a57809d1660459109bb2fc51caf09f1c1867d0d76e6a681
spent
true